Output 39c303973c479044ef6ac260b74a7ff55c4ab94eb7a760a330f3e790d0317f9e:43

value
235923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a2dd8ec54fd9292a2af204a8303651d7ea5ce84 OP_EQUAL
address
3HCqiggrBF5pNrsaANT93yw4Bi4NHcYrKZ
transaction
39c303973c479044ef6ac260b74a7ff55c4ab94eb7a760a330f3e790d0317f9e
spent
true